Technical Problem

Current therapies targeting regulatory T cells in tumors using anti-CTLA4 antibodies often cause systemic activation of T-effector cells, leading to excessive toxicity and limited therapeutic utility.

Method used

Development of IKZF2-specific modulators or degraders that can selectively target regulatory T cells in tumors without activating T-effector cells, thereby reducing systemic toxicity.

Benefits of technology

The proposed process for synthesizing IKZF2-specific modulators or degraders allows for more efficient preparation of optically pure compounds with fewer synthetic steps, reduced waste, and less chromatographic purification, potentially leading to a more tolerable and less toxic therapy for cancer treatment.

Abstract

The present disclosure relates generally to processes for preparing compounds that bind to cereblon, thereby modulating cereblon activity, and the synthetic intermediates prepared thereby.
